Men’s Bowls

29 July, 2026 By Canowindra Phoenix Editor

Two great games of Major Triples were played last weekend. On Saturday, Dool, Peter Taylor and Roger played Michael and Graham Traves and Brad Bourke. Dool’s team jumped out of the gates early leading 10/2 after 4 ends. Michael’s team pegged back the lead with the scores even on the 9th end 12/12. The game see-sawed until the 17th when Dool’s team won the remaining ends to win 26/19. It was great to see a good crowd watching in the somewhat cool conditions.

On Sunday, Dool’s teamed backed-up to play Phil and Brent Lees and Jamie Grant.

The weather was a fraction warmer, making conditions for play a little better. Dool’s team went to early lead but the Lees team slowly pegged the margin back to lead.

Neither team gave an inch and holding the shot changed regularly on each end. Over the last two ends the Lees team proved too strong and went on to win by six shots.

Jamie Grant led very well and his game has improved significantly over the last month.

Phil, Brent and Jamie G are now in the final and will have to wait for a while to know who their opponents are, due to work and other bowls commitments.

On Sunday 2 August, two games are scheduled with the final of minor pairs final (depending results of rookie singles on Sat

urday). There will also be an O’Brien Cup game, with Michael and Graham Traves versus Brad Bourke and Cristy SullivanWebb at 1pm.

On Saturday the 8 August, Canowindra will be co hosting versatile pairs with Cowra Bowling Club. We have six teams involved and there is a total of 70 teams entered.

There will be 28 teams from all over NSW playing. The format on the Saturday is three different ways of playing pairs game.

All games are at Cowra on Sunday 9 August. Over the next month, we have several players involved in various zone events and wish them all the best.
